CD68
CD68 (CD68 Molecule)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with CD68 include Granular Cell Tumor and Breast Granular Cell Tumor. Among its related pathways are Hematopoietic Stem Cell Differentiation Pathways and Lineage-specific Markers and Innate Immune System. An important paralog of this gene is LAMP1.
